Summary
The Nebraska Department of Education has announced a $1 million investment aimed at expanding teacher apprenticeship programs through its 'Grow Your Own' initiative. This funding will support partnerships between Chadron State College and the University of Nebraska–Lincoln, creating new pathways for aspiring educators to gain hands-on classroom experience while earning a salary.
This initiative highlights the importance of registered apprenticeship programs in addressing workforce shortages, particularly in education. By cultivating local talent and providing financial support, Nebraska is taking significant steps to ensure that students have access to qualified teachers, thereby strengthening communities and the overall education system.
